小孩编程班学什么好

worktile 其他 2

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    小孩编程班学什么好?

    小孩编程班是一种培养孩子计算思维和创造力的教育方式。编程能力在当今社会中变得越来越重要。学习编程不仅可以培养孩子的逻辑思维和问题解决能力,还可以帮助他们在未来的职业道路上取得优势。那么,小孩编程班应该学什么呢?

    1. 编程基础知识:在小孩编程班中,首先要学习的是编程的基础知识。这包括掌握常见的编程语言和编程概念,学习如何编写简单的代码和程序。最常见的编程语言包括Scratch、Python和Java等。通过学习这些基础知识,孩子可以了解编程的基本原理和结构,为以后的学习打下坚实的基础。

    2. 计算思维能力培养:编程是一种培养计算思维能力的有效工具。在小孩编程班中,孩子可以通过解决各种问题和编写程序来培养自己的计算思维能力。计算思维是一种将问题抽象化、分解化和解决化的能力,对于孩子未来的学习和工作都具有重要意义。

    3. 创造力培养:编程不仅可以培养孩子的逻辑思维能力,还可以激发他们的创造力。在小孩编程班中,孩子可以学习如何构思并实现自己的创意。通过编写代码和程序,孩子可以制作自己的游戏、动画和应用等,发挥自己的想象力和创造力。这不仅可以增强孩子的自信心,还可以培养他们的创造力和创新思维。

    4. 解决现实问题能力培养:编程也可以帮助孩子学会如何解决现实生活中的问题。在小孩编程班中,孩子可以学习如何应用编程知识来解决实际问题,比如设计一个简单的智能物联网系统,编写一个自动化控制程序等。通过这种方式,孩子可以将编程应用到日常生活中,培养他们解决问题和创造价值的能力。

    总的来说,小孩编程班可以帮助孩子培养计算思维能力、创造力和解决问题的能力。在学习过程中,孩子不仅可以获取编程知识,还可以锻炼自己的思维和创造能力。因此,小孩编程班的学习对孩子未来的发展具有重要意义。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    小孩参加编程班可以学到许多有用的技能和知识,以下是学习编程对小孩的好处:

    1. 训练逻辑思维能力:编程是一门逻辑性很强的学科,通过编程训练可以帮助小孩培养逻辑思维能力。在编程过程中,小孩需要按照一定的逻辑顺序编写代码,这可以帮助他们锻炼思维的清晰度和逻辑性。

    2. 培养问题解决能力:编程过程中经常会遇到各种问题和错误,小孩需要通过分析和解决这些问题来调试代码。这可以帮助他们培养问题解决能力和学会运用适当的策略来解决困难。

    3. 培养创造力和创新精神:编程是一门创造性和创新性很强的学科,通过编程可以激发小孩的创造力和创新精神。他们可以通过编程创作自己的作品,设计独特的游戏、网站或应用程序,这对于培养他们的创造力和创新能力非常有益。

    4. 培养团队合作意识:编程项目往往需要小孩与其他人合作完成,这可以培养小孩的团队合作意识和合作能力。他们需要与团队成员沟通、分工合作、协调工作进度等,这对于培养他们的团队合作能力有很大的帮助。

    5. 培养信息技术素养:在当今信息化的社会中,了解和掌握基本的计算机和编程知识对于小孩来说非常重要。参加编程班可以帮助小孩掌握计算机基础知识和相关技能,提高他们的信息技术素养,为将来的学习和就业打下良好的基础。

    综上所述,参加编程班可以帮助小孩培养逻辑思维能力、问题解决能力、创造力和创新精神、团队合作意识以及提高信息技术素养。这些技能和知识不仅对小孩在学习上有帮助,也能在他们的未来发展中提供更多机会和竞争优势。因此,学习编程对于小孩来说是非常有益的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在小孩编程班中学习编程可以为孩子提供很多好处。编程不仅仅是掌握一种技能,还可以培养孩子的逻辑思维、创造力和问题解决能力。此外,它还教会孩子团队合作和沟通能力。下面将介绍在小孩编程班学习编程的一些好的课程内容和方法。

    一、基础编程知识

    1. 简介:在小孩编程班中,首先要学习的是基础的编程概念和知识。这包括理解编程语言、变量、循环、条件语句等基本概念。

    2. 学习方法:
      (1)图形化编程:对于小孩子来说,学习编程可以从图形化编程开始。图形化编程工具可以通过拖拽和连接图形块,轻松实现程序功能。例如Scratch、Blockly等工具。
      (2)在线编程平台:在小孩编程班中,可以使用在线编程平台来学习编程。这些平台提供了丰富的教学资源和课程内容,孩子可以通过这些平台进行学习和练习。
      (3)游戏式学习:为了让孩子更加享受学习编程的过程,可以使用一些游戏式的学习资源。这些资源将编程概念和知识嵌入到有趣的游戏情境中,孩子可以在游戏中学习和实践编程的技能。

    二、创造性编程项目

    1. 简介:在掌握了基本的编程概念和知识之后,孩子可以开始进行一些创造性的编程项目。这些项目可以是编写简单的小程序、编写简单的游戏等。

    2. 学习方法:
      (1)项目驱动学习:让孩子自己选择感兴趣的主题,然后根据主题设计和实现一个简单的项目。例如,制作一个迷宫游戏、一个画板程序等。这样孩子可以将自己的创意转化为实际的程序,并获得成就感和满足感。
      (2)合作编程:在小孩编程班中,可以鼓励孩子进行合作编程。让他们一起完成一个更复杂的项目,可以培养他们的团队协作和沟通能力。

    三、硬件编程

    1. 简介:硬件编程是指将编程与物理硬件相结合。在小孩编程班中,可以学习如何使用Arduino、Micro:bit等硬件平台进行编程。

    2. 学习方法:
      (1)实验驱动学习:通过一些简单的实验和项目,让孩子了解硬件编程的基本原理和操作方法。例如,通过编程控制LED灯的闪烁、使用温度传感器等。
      (2)自主创作:鼓励孩子进行自主创作,设计和实现自己的硬件项目。例如制作一个智能灯光系统、一个遥控小车等。这样不仅加强了孩子的编程能力,还培养了他们的创造力和解决问题的能力。

    总结:在小孩编程班学习编程,可以从基础编程知识开始,然后进行一些创造性项目和硬件编程。通过这样的学习,孩子可以培养逻辑思维、创造力和解决问题的能力,并获得成就感和满足感。此外,鼓励合作编程和自主创作也可以培养孩子的团队合作和创新能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部